What makes the Logitech MX Keys Mini different from a full-size keyboard?
The Logitech MX Keys Mini drops the number pad and cuts the width to 296 mm, roughly a third narrower than a standard board. That frees desk space and pulls your mouse hand closer, keeping your shoulders in a more natural position. You keep the full letter, number, and function rows, so nothing you type daily is missing. It also adds dedicated keys the full MX Keys lacks: a microphone mute button, a dictation key, and an emoji key. For anyone who rarely uses a number pad, the smaller footprint is the main draw.

How long does the Logitech MX Keys Mini battery last on one charge?
A full charge lasts up to 10 days with the backlight on, or up to five months with backlighting switched off. The keyboard uses a built-in rechargeable lithium-polymer battery, so there are no AA batteries to replace. When it runs low, you charge it over the included USB-C cable, and a quick top-up returns hours of use. The backlight also turns itself off when your hands move away and brightens as they approach, which stretches each charge further. Can the Logitech MX Keys Mini connect to my phone, tablet, and laptop at the same time?
Yes. The Logitech MX Keys Mini pairs with up to three devices over Bluetooth and switches between them using the Easy-Switch keys along the top row. You might set key one for your work laptop, key two for an iPad, and key three for your phone, then jump between them with a single tap. Does the Logitech MX Keys Mini work with Windows, Mac, iPad, and Android?
It works across all of them. The Logitech MX Keys Mini supports Windows 10 or later, macOS 10.15 or later, ChromeOS, iPadOS 14 or later, iOS 14 or later, Android 8.0 or later, and Linux. Basic typing works right away on any of these once paired over Bluetooth. To remap keys or fine-tune the backlight, you install the free Logi Options+ app on Windows or Mac. The layout carries both Windows and Mac key markings, so Kenyan users running mixed setups, such as a Windows work laptop and a personal MacBook, get the correct shortcuts on each.

Does the keyboard backlight work in low light, and does it drain the battery?
The backlight uses a proximity sensor and an ambient light sensor. Keys light up the moment your hands approach and dim or switch off when you step away, and they brighten automatically in darker rooms. This makes typing easy during early mornings or evening load-shedding without wasting power. Because the light only runs when needed, backlight-on battery life still reaches about 10 days. If you want the longest possible runtime, you can turn backlighting off completely and stretch a single charge to roughly five months. You control all of this through Logi Options+.

Technical Specifications

Typing Hardware and Key Feel
  • Scissor-switch keys with a 1.8 mm total travel distance give a firm, quiet keypress that reduces typing errors.
  • Spherically dished keycaps curve to match fingertips, guiding fingers to key centres and speeding up touch typing.
  • Standard keys rated for 10 million keypresses, so heavy daily typing will not wear them down for years.
  • Function-row keys rated for 5 million presses, matching lighter shortcut use over the keyboard's lifetime.
  • Low-profile keys sit flat, cutting finger travel and easing fatigue during long writing or coding sessions.
  • Dedicated mute, dictation, and emoji keys handle calls and messaging without opening on-screen menus.
Backlighting and Ambient Sensors
  • Automatic backlight lights the keys as your hands approach and switches off when you step away to save power.
  • A proximity sensor detects your hands, while an ambient light sensor adjusts brightness to match the room.
